Conclusion Cinema 4D R19 can sometimes run on Windows 11 with varied success, but it was not designed for the OS and may exhibit graphical, stability, licensing, or plugin-related issues. Users should weigh the costs of troubleshooting and risk against productivity needs. Practical steps—compatibility mode, legacy drivers, VMs, or maintaining older OS installations—can bridge the gap, while the most robust long-term solution is migrating to a supported Cinema 4D release and updated plugins. Maxon’s Cinema 4D Release 19 (R19) is remembered as a cornerstone version, introducing major viewport improvements, the groundbreaking ProRender, and enhanced Voronoi Fracture, all released back in 2017. However, with the release of Windows 11 and newer Windows 10 builds (20H2 and later), many users have reported that R19—along with R20—fails to start or closes immediately upon launching.

If Cinema 4D launches but you see a blank viewport or experience extreme lag, Windows 11 might be trying to run the 3D application on your energy-efficient integrated graphics card instead of your powerful dedicated GPU. You can fix this by forcing Windows to always use the high-performance GPU for R19.
